Counselling & Therapy Modalities Used

Counselling-  I use a variety of counselling techniques to fit in with your needs and desired outcomes. Counselling modalities include, Solution Focused Therapy,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, Mindfulness-based Therapy and Narrative therapy. My counselling approach is always person-centered, client directed, and trauma informed. 
 

Kinesiology - Kinesiology is a complimentary alternative healing therapy that assists the body to help heal itself. It is a gentle non-invasive modality that uses muscle monitoring to access the Mental, Emotional, Spiritual and Physical state of the body and mind. Kinesiology is the science of energy balancing and is grounded by Anatomy and Physiology.
